- The distance between Coen, Queensland, Australia and Aepto.San Luis, Colombia is approximately 15,293 km or 9,503 mi.
- To reach Coen, Queensland in this distance one would set out from Aepto.San Luis bearing 250°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Coen, Queensland bearing 284.5° or WNW .
- Coen, Queensland has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Aepto.San Luis has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b).
- Coen, Queensland is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Aepto.San Luis is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 14.2 °C (25.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4 °C (7.2°F) more in Coen, Queensland.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 191 mm (7.5 in) more which is equivalent to 191 l/m² (4.69 US gal/ft²) or 1,910,000 l/ha (204,192 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.3° lower in Coen, Queensland than in Aepto.San Luis.
